Abstract
CO2 hydrogenation activity of nickel-magnesium-aluminum mixed oxide catalysts was investigated. As Ni concentration increased, CO2 conversion increased due to the increased active metal content and suppression of NiAl2O4 formation. Calcination temperature was found to affect the textural properties of catalysts and to decrease surface area and pore volume significantly.
